A Bullied Student, and an Amazing Deed

In this story, a young student was getting his car vandalized because he was gay. On the car there where homophobic slurs keyed onto the car, his tires where slashed, and more. The student and his family where barely able to pay for the students college alone. After a body shop called 'Auto Paint and Body' heard his story they called him in and fixed his car for free. Not only did they fix the damages free of cost but they also did many custom things that amounted to 10,000 for nothing. I love this story because right now the world is a scary and hateful place.
